Westgate NFL Handicapping SuperContest (3 Weeks to Go)

 

WESTGATE SUPERCONTEST UPDATE (WEEK 16)

When the NFL regular season kicked-off back in early September , if you told me we’d be in this position with just three weeks to go, I’d be ecstatic.

Right now, between all the tickets, we have 321 combined wins on 525 total picks — which is a 61.14 percent win rate. Collectively speaking, all the tickets are +117 wins above the .500 mark.

However, this is no time for celebration.

We’re now down to the final three weeks of the contest. With the mandatory 5 picks to make every week on each ticket, that’s 15 possible points at stake (since one point is given for each win). While I’m thrilled with these results, I’m also unsatisfied. I’m also wary of running up impressive win percentages, but then getting nothing more back in prize money. Accordingly, all decisions from this point forward will be based on moving up in standings and winning prize money. Hitting 61 percent winners, but then not making a cent means nothing. We are going for an in-the-money finish, hopefully on multiple tickets.

Recall how we got here.  There were 1,301 entries in the contest. We purchased 7 of those entries, which means there was a total $7,000 investment. The good news is — all 7 of those tickets currently rank in the top 200. So, it’s possible any or all 7 tickets could still reach the money. However, realistically speaking, no more than 3 tickets are more likely to make the money. Moreover, 3 tickets could still even win the contest (main event). Note that 1 ticket currently stands alone in 9th place. And, 1 ticket is tied for 17th place. Remember, the main event contest pays only the top-20, with $200,000 for first place plus the “champion” title. So, this all means we would have 2 tickets in-the-money — if the contest ended now. We also have 1 ticket tied for 27th place, easily within striking distance. So, that’s three tickets ranked in the top 36.

In the second-half contest (which means the best results of weeks 10-18), we have 1 ticket tied for 3rd place. In fact, we have 5 tickets ranked in the top 50, which certainly could cash. No one in the contest is even close to this figure. Trouble is, it’s $75,000 for first, and pays just five spots (75K – 40K – 20K – 10K – 5K). So, we must take 5th place, or higher to get a payout.

Obviously, these 3 best tickets will receive the greatest care and attention. However, with the 4 other tickets, we are likely to get more aggressive, especially on the longshot tickets. Note that 1 ticket is tied for 91st place in the main event, and with a good run, could still climb into the money. The other tickets need help and would need to go something like 12-3 or better to have any realistic shot to move into the money. However, these tickets could also be live on the second-half contest, which mans they were be taken seriously. That said, we can’t necessarily “play it safe” on these lower-ranked tickets….unless….unless….

…..we want to concentrate on the last mini-contest (weeks 16-18), and just play it safe and make optimal picks. Recall, we won a mini-contest already for $25,000 (for the week 10-12 contest), but we are starting afresh with 1,301 contestants, so this should not be an expectation.

Let me discuss the status of each ticket, because they are each at a different status:

TICKET 1: Currently stands all alone in 9th place in the main event. Based on prize money from last season, that would pay about $8,900 if we remain in the same place. The ticket is 2.5 points out of 1st place, so we need to average gaining 1 point (one more winning pick) per week. But also keep in mind other tickets could also get hot and climb. Obviously, if this ticket can continue on the same pace as we are doing, we could win it all. Since the SuperContest winner last season ended up with 60.5 points, and the current leader is at 51.5 points, given that this ticket is at 49 points, we need to go 10-5 or better to have any shot and more like 11-4 or 12-3 for higher confidence. The good news is, since 55.5 points cashed last season, even a 7-8 or better record could get us into the money on Ticket 1. But we’re not playing for 20th place on this ticket. We’re aiming for 1st. More good news: This ticket ranks in 15th place in the second-half contest, and is 2.5 points (wins) behind the current leader. So, strong results not only move this ticket up the main event money ladder, it could also land a payout in the top-5 of the second-half contest.

TICKET 3: Currently stands tied in 17th place along with 9 other players in the main event (which means, we’d all carve up the 17th-20th prize money if the contest ended now). This stands at 48 points. That’s 3.5 points behind the contest leader. But here’s the great news: This ticket ranks in a tie for 3rd place in the second-half contest. This ticket is huge, and perhaps has a higher +EV than Ticket 1 given it’s ranked so high in two contest segments.

TICKET 2: Currently stands tied for 27th place. That’s only 7 spots out of the money. This ticket is also 3 games out of first place in the second half contest….but remember, there’s only 15 games/picks to go. If this can stay close to the money, it could provide some hedge opportunities in the final week. Let’s hope we get to that strategy discussion.

TICKET(S) 4-7: These are all half game to a full game behind those tickets discussed above, but since they’re still in the running to cash in both contests, we’ll treat them seriously, yet also take a few outliers as a hedge against the best tickets stumbling. Ideally, one of these will go 5-0 this week, and climb into contention with the other tickets, as well as be the leader in the final mini-contest (weeks 16-18).

TICKET(S) 5-6: Needs lots of help. With a miracle run 13-2 or bettor, these could still cash. We’re at 43.5 points and it’s probably going to take 55 points (or higher) to cash.  So, 13-2 is the only way these may return money.  These tickets are pretty much dead, except on the last mini-contest.

Finally, to say these upcoming games are now worth thousands of dollars is an understatement. The difference between 1st and second is likely to be just a point. Perhaps a half point (which happens with a push). Players will also likely tie for some prize money spots, so every step up the money ladder is worth thousands in prize money, and perhaps even tens of thousands of dollars.
